Frankie Bridge used her Instagram Stories on Thursday to share videos in which she received injections in her neck.

The TV personality, 34, admitted to being ‘nervous’ when she visited a clinic in London to undergo the treatment.

She explained that she was trying to relieve the tension in her neck that resulted from clenching her jaw too often.

Frankie said, “No matter how many massages I get… I’m a big jaw clench. So I always have tension neck pain, which always leads to tension headaches. So I thought I’d try something new with @natalikellyldn’.

Aesthetic doctor Natali Kelly then explained the treatment, saying she would inject a neuromodulator to relax the muscles for “less pain and an elongated, gooseneck.”

She then marked on Frankie’s neck where to place the needle and then told her to breathe in as she did the injections.

Frankie confessed to her followers, “I was definitely nervous. Can you tell?! But I actually felt nothing! Relief! I’ll let you know if it helps!’

Natali added that Frankie was probably stressed because of her starring role in the West End show 2:22 A Ghost Story.
